AI Contract Overview
The contract requires the identification of hazardous components within medical devices and the preparation or validation of Safety Data Sheets that comply with OSHA and DLA regulations. This effort is critical to ensuring that all chemical and material risks associated with medical devices are accurately documented and communicated in accordance with federal safety standards. The work must align with the specific technical and regulatory expectations of the Department of Defense’s Medical Supply Chain, particularly for items deployed in operational environments where safety and compliance are non-negotiable. The solicitation is classified as a subcontract under NAICS code 541620, indicating it involves scientific and technical consulting services focused on environmental and safety compliance. The response deadline is August 5, 2026, and performance is expected to occur at FPO, ZIP 96694, suggesting the work may support military medical logistics operations, potentially including overseas or forward-deployed settings. While no set-aside provisions or point of contact are specified, the emphasis on regulatory validation and hazardous material handling underscores the need for qualified expertise in chemical safety, regulatory documentation, and defense supply chain protocols.
